Deleting an

SNMPv3

Community

Table Entry

To delete an entry in the SNMPv3 Community Table, perform the following
procedure:

1. From the home page, select Configuration.

The Configuration System page is displayed with the General tab
selected by default, as shown in Figure 5 on page 38.

2. Select the SNMP tab.

The SNMP tab is shown in Figure 89 on page 234.

3. In the SNMPv3 section, click the button next to Configure

Community Table and then click Configure at the bottom of the tab.

The SNMPv3 Community Table tab is shown in Figure 111 on page
283
.

4. Click the button next to the SNMPv3 Community Table entry that you

want to delete and then click Remove.

A warning message is displayed.

5. Click OK.

6. From the Configuration menu, select the Save Config option to

permanently save your changes. (This option is not displayed if there
are no changes to save.)
